php登录ip(代码示例)

ThinkPhpchengxu

温馨提示:这篇文章已超过239天没有更新,请注意相关的内容是否还可用!

php登录ip(代码示例)

要实现PHP登录IP功能,可以通过获取用户的IP地址并进行验证来实现。在PHP中,可以使用`$_SERVER['REMOTE_ADDR']`来获取用户的IP地址。这个变量会返回用户的IPv4或IPv6地址。

下面是一个示例代码,演示了如何获取用户的IP地址并进行验证:

// 获取用户的IP地址

$ip = $_SERVER['REMOTE_ADDR'];

// 验证IP地址是否合法

if (filter_var($ip, FILTER_VALIDATE_IP)) {

// IP地址合法,进行登录操作

// 这里可以写下登录操作的代码

echo "登录成功!";

} else {

// IP地址不合法,登录失败

echo "登录失败!";

}

在上面的示例代码中,首先使用`$_SERVER['REMOTE_ADDR']`获取用户的IP地址,并将其赋值给变量`$ip`。然后,使用`filter_var()`函数验证IP地址的合法性。如果IP地址合法,则输出"登录成功!";如果IP地址不合法,则输出"登录失败!"。

通过以上的示例代码,我们可以实现对用户IP地址的登录验证。根据具体的需求,可以在登录操作的代码块中添加更多的逻辑来实现更复杂的功能,比如记录登录日志、限制登录次数等。

文章版权声明:除非注明,否则均为莫宇前端原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码